#714365 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#714365 is composed of 44.3% red, 26.3% green and 39.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.7% magenta, 10.6%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 315.7 degrees, a saturation of 25.6% and a lightness of 35.3%. #714365 color hex could be obtained by blending #e286ca with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#714365

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020102 is the darkest color, while #f9f5f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#714365

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c585b is the less saturated color, while #af0583 is the most saturated one.
